The CS5166H buck regulator can be used with a wide
range of external power components to optimize the cost
and performance of a particular design. The following
information can be used as general guidelines to assist in
their selection.
NFET Power Transistors
Both logic level and standard FETs can be used. The refer-
ence designs derive gate drive from the 12V supply which
is generally available in most computer systems and utilize
logic level FETs. A charge pump may be easily implement-
ed to permit use of standard FET’s or support 5V or 12V
only systems (maximum of 20V). Multiple FET’s may be
paralleled to reduce losses and improve efficiency and
thermal management.

Voltage applied to the FET gates depends on the applica-
tion circuit used. Both upper and lower gate driver outputs
are specified to drive to within 1.5V of ground when in the
low state and to within 2V of their respective bias supplies
when in the high state. In practice, the FET gates will be
driven rail to rail due to overshoot caused by the capacitive
load they present to the controller IC. For the typical appli-
cation where VCC = 12V and 5V is used as the source for
the regulator output current, the following gate drive is
provided:
VGS (TOP) = 12V - 5V = 7V, VGS(BOTTOM) = 12V,

External Output Enable Circuit
On/off control of the regulator can be implemented
through the addition of two additional discrete compo-
nents (see Figure 19). This circuit operates by pulling the
Soft Start pin high, and the ISENSE pin low, emulating a cur-
rent limit condition.
